If youve ever wanted to try out liquid eyeliner, but felt intimidated by it, youre not alone. Liquid eyeliner can be challenging to master, but with a few simple tips and tricks, youll be able to create a variety of looks with ease! Heres a liquid eyeliner tutorial for beginners. Before you start, make sure you have the right tools. Youll need a good quality liquid eyeliner pen or brush, as well as a good eye makeup remover. 1. Start with clean, dry eyes. Make sure your eyelids are free of any makeup or oils before applying your liquid eyeliner.

2. Begin by creating a thin line along the upper lash line. Dip the tip of your liquid eyeliner pen or brush into the product and slowly draw a thin line along the top of your lashes. Start at the inner corner of the eye and work your way outward.

3. If you want to create a more dramatic look, you can thicken the line as you move outward. You can also use an angled brush to create a thicker line that follows the natural shape of your eye.

4. To create a more cat-eye look, extend the line outward and angle it upward at the outer corner of the eye.

5. To finish off the look, you can add a few dots along the upper lash line to create a more intense look.

And thats it! With just a few easy steps, you can create a variety of looks with liquid eyeliner. Dont be afraid to experiment and have fun with it!
